This non-compliance notice initiates a process that could ultimately lead to the delisting of B. Riley Financial's common stock from the Nasdaq exchange. While delisting doesn't necessarily mean the company is insolvent or failing, it significantly impacts its liquidity, investor confidence, and access to capital. Delisting often results in a lower share price and reduced trading volume, making it harder for investors to buy or sell the stock. It also signals to the market a potential underlying problem with the company's performance or financial stability.
